This reliable machine, known for its precision and efficiency in the category of parallel lathes, features a turning length of 1500 mm and a turning diameter of 630 mm, making it a versatile choice for various machining applications. With a turning speed of up to 2240 rpm, the TOS SUI 63 NC is designed for high-performance tasks, ensuring that you can achieve the desired results with speed and accuracy.
